Frequent Roofing Issues That Demand Professional Help
Roofing installations can face a range of common challenges that require professional intervention. One frequent issue is roof leaks, which can stem from damaged shingles, flashing, or worn seals. Moreover, improper installation or general deterioration can lead to sagging roofs, undermining structural integrity. Another common concern involves clogged gutters, which can create water pooling and subsequent damage to the roofing materials. Moreover, homeowners may experience issues with moss and algae growth, which can damage shingles and lead to further complications. Finally, insufficient ventilation can cause excessive heat and moisture accumulation, creating an environment for mold growth. Identifying these issues early and seeking professional help can prevent more extensive damage and costly repairs in the long run.

The Roof's Age
Even though a well-maintained roof can remain functional for many years, age stands as a critical factor in establishing whether a replacement is essential. Typically, asphalt shingles might last from 20 to 30 years, while metal roofs can survive up to 50 years or more. As roofs age, their capacity to withstand environmental stresses decreases, resulting in potential complications. Homeowners should think about a roof replacement when it approaches the end of its estimated lifespan, even if visible damage is not noticeable. Warning Signs Of Damage
Homeowners need to stay watchful for indicators of damage that may signal the need for a roof replacement. Standard warning signs include absent or fractured shingles, which open up the underlying structure to moisture. Moreover, warped or bent shingles demonstrate deterioration, while granules building up in gutters may suggest considerable wear. Indications of water stains or mold on ceiling or wall areas indicate potential leaks, calling for immediate attention. A sagging roofline can further point to structural issues requiring urgent evaluation. In addition, if the roof is close to or beyond its expected lifespan, proactive measures should be taken into account. By identifying these signs early, homeowners can make informed decisions about their roofing needs, potentially avoiding costly repairs down the line.

Typical Roofing Materials
Selecting the suitable roofing material is vital for guaranteeing long-lasting performance and aesthetic appeal in residential properties. Homeowners usually select from several common roofing materials, each offering distinct benefits. Asphalt shingles are among the most widely used due to their budget-friendly nature and versatility. Metal roofing, valued for its longevity and energy efficiency, is gaining traction in various climates. Clay and concrete tiles provide a distinctive look and exceptional durability, making them perfect for warmer regions. Wood shakes or shingles offer a natural aesthetic, though they may require more maintenance. Last but not least, slate roofing, while more expensive, offers a classic appearance and outstanding longevity. Understanding these options helps homeowners in making informed decisions concerning their roofing needs.
Material Longevity Factors
While property owners often focus on visual appeal and cost, the endurance of roofing materials is a critical factor that cannot be overlooked. Selecting the right material can substantially affect a roof's longevity and performance. Common options include asphalt shingles, metal, tile, and slate, each delivering varying levels of resilience against weather elements. Asphalt shingles, while economical, usually last 15-30 years, whereas metal roofs can endure up to 50 years or more. Clay and concrete tiles offer exceptional longevity and resistance to fire, but their weight requires appropriate structural support. Homeowners should assess local climate conditions and potential wear factors when making their selection, as these considerations will finally affect both maintenance needs and replacement frequency over time.

What Matters When Selecting a Roofing Contractor?
When searching for a trustworthy roofing contractor, what key qualities should a homeowner prioritize? To begin with, a contractor's license and insurance are essential, as they reflect professionalism and protect homeowners from liability. Experience in the roofing industry is likewise essential; seasoned contractors often have a track record of quality work. Homeowners should search for references and reviews to gauge customer satisfaction and reliability. Additionally, a good contractor will provide comprehensive written estimates, offering transparency in pricing and scope of work. Communication skills must not be ignored, as clear communication fosters trust and smooth project execution. Finally, a solid warranty on workmanship and materials demonstrates confidence in the services offered, giving homeowners confidence with respect to their investment.

Frequently Asked Questions
What Warranty Coverage Do Roofing Contractors Typically Offer?
Roofing contractors typically offer warranties that include warranties for materials that address defects and workmanship warranties that ensure proper installation. These warranties vary in length and coverage, providing clients with protection against future issues related to roofing.
What's the Average Timeframe for a Roofing Project?
A roof installation typically requires anywhere from a couple of days to multiple weeks, depending on factors such as project size, complexity, weather conditions, and the materials being utilized by the contractors working on the project.
Can I Remain at Home While Roof Repairs Are Being Done?
In the course of roof repairs, homeowners may typically stay in their homes, but noise and disturbances might take place. It is recommended to discuss with the roofing contractor to gauge safety and comfort during the repair process.
What Should I Do When My Roof Is Damaged by a Storm?
If storm damage occurs to a roof, the homeowner should examine the damage, document it with photos, contact their insurance company, and retain a qualified roofing professional for repairs to guarantee safe and proper restoration.
